LOWAN MALLEEKEY FINDINGSDue to the unsuitability of the dry sandy soils foragriculture, more than half of the Lowan Mallee remainslargely-intact. Beyond this – in the fragmented landscape– 57% of native vegetation remains. A high proportion ofremnant native vegetation occurs on public land (43.5%),with good representation in the reserve system (28.2% ofthe total fragmented landscape). The proportion <strong>by</strong> areaof all patch size categories is slightly greater on privateland than public land, except the largest patches (1,000+ha) where the proportion <strong>by</strong> area is substantially greateron public land compared to private land. This is particularlyevident south of the Big Desert Wilderness Area wherenative vegetation has been cleared for agriculture.Although native vegetation here is fragmented, remnantsremain moderate in connectivity and site condition, andlinear roadsides feature strongly.
